Ingredients and Weight:
- Sugar: 500 grams
- Cream: 200 milliliters
- Butter: 100 grams
- Sea salt: 1 teaspoon
- Vanilla extract: 1 teaspoon (optional)
Preparation Time:
- Preparation: 15 minutes
- Cooking: 30 minutes
- Total: 45 minutes
Difficulty Level: 3 (Moderate)
Preparation Method Steps:
- In a heavy-bottomed saucepan, combine sugar and 3 tablespoons of water.
- Place over medium-high heat and stir until sugar dissolves.
- Once dissolved, stop stirring and let the sugar boil until it turns amber color. Be careful not to burn it.
- Reduce heat to low and slowly pour cream into caramel while stirring continuously. Be careful as the caramel may splatter and be hot.
- Add butter and sea salt and stir until combined.
- Add vanilla extract, if using, and mix well.
- Pour into a prepared baking dish lined with baking paper and let cool completely.
- Once cooled, break into pieces or cut into desired shapes.

Special Precautions and Tips:
- Be careful when handling hot caramel as it can splatter and cause burns.
- Use a heavy-bottomed saucepan to ensure even heating and prevent burning.
- Keep an eye on the caramel while it's boiling as it can burn easily. Adjust heat if necessary to maintain a gentle boil.
